Transaction 75051bd98788dd45345e072cf8421f1775da560f0495c313d35b0b452928b0ec
1 Input
2 Outputs
- 75051bd98788dd45345e072cf8421f1775da560f0495c313d35b0b452928b0ec:0
- 75051bd98788dd45345e072cf8421f1775da560f0495c313d35b0b452928b0ec:1
value 209121689
address 1L7YLiDmEnBgnq3ind7NVdmarQ4AiCLZYp
value 719374629
address 123pL334eunHki4c9TgwGD6bfwS23QRunX